UV spectroscopy is usually a type of absorption spectroscopy wherein mild with the ultra-violet area (200-400 nm) is absorbed via the molecule which leads to the excitation of your electrons from the bottom state to a higher Strength condition.

Bathochromic impact: An influence during which the absorption most is shifted to a longer wavelength mainly because of the presence of the autochrome or even a solvent transform. Red shifts are often called bathochromic shifts.

Influence of Conjugation: Conjugation in molecules can change the absorption peak. When chromophores are conjugated, the absorption peak shifts to an more info extended wavelength. An increase in the amount of conjugated bonds can cause the absorption of visible mild, imparting color to compounds.
